FSA ULaval Reaffirms Its Position Among the World’s Best Business Schools
Friday January 31st, 2020
PRESS RELEASE
Université Laval’s Faculty of Business Administration (FSA ULaval) is delighted to announce that its AACSB International accreditation has been extended for five years. This accreditation provides international recognition of the quality of the Faculty’s overall offering and allows it to maintain its position among the best business schools on the planet.
From November 3 to 5, 2019, the Association to Advance Collegiate Schools of Business (AACSB) Peer Review Team visited FSA ULaval to assess its compliance with the conditions to extend the AACSB accreditation that had come to term. After completing this process, the Team issued a recommendation to extend the accreditation until 2025. This recommendation was ratified by the AACSB Board of Directors.
“It is with great pride that we welcome the news that the accreditation has been extended for five years. This international recognition, which testifies to the quality of our Faculty, not only reflects on our professors, researchers and personnel, but especially on our students who make a mark for themselves on the national and international scene. This seal of excellence reaffirms our position among the leading business education institutions in the world,” stated Michel Gendron, Dean of the Faculty of Business Administration at Université Laval.
This extension also certifies the Faculty’s quality with other universities and foreign students who rely on this accreditation to enter into partnerships or decide on which university to attend abroad.
Several members of the Faculty attended official meetings with the Team: the Executive Management Team, heads of departments and research chairs or centres, professors and lecturers, students from all three academic levels, pedagogical and technological support employees, student placement services representatives, as well as members of the Council for the Advancement of the Faculty.
The Peer Review Team was composed of Mr. Jim Dewald, Team Chair and Dean of Haskayne Business School, University of Calgary; Ms. Deborah F. Spake, Dean of the College of Business Administration, Kent State University; and Ms. Hanna-Leena Pesonen, Dean of the Jyväskylä University School of Business and Economics (Finland).
